Were looking for a passionate and experienced Team Manager to lead our Learning Disability and Autism (LD and A) South Team at Suffolk County Council.

Whether youre a Senior Practitioner or Social Worker ready to progress or an established Team Manager seeking a new challenge we want to hear from you.

Your role and responsibilities

Based at Landmark House in Ipswich the Learning Disability and South Team is part of a dynamic and evolving service that puts people first. We work creatively and collaboratively to support adults with learning disabilities and autism to live fulfilling independent lives.

As Team Manager youll:

  • lead and support a dedicated team of social care professionals
  • promote a culture of continuous learning and development
  • ensure statutory duties are met under the Care Act 2014 Mental Capacity Act 2005 and Mental Health Act 1983 (2007)
  • work closely with partners across health advocacy and community services.

You will need

  • a recognised Social Work qualification and Social Work England registration
  • proven experience in Learning Disability and Autism services and multi-agency collaboration
  • strong leadership skills and the ability to guide teams through change
  • a commitment to risk-positive strengths-based practice
  • an interest in innovative approaches including digital solutions.

The team

The Learning Disability and Autism South Team embraces a strengths-based approach guided by the Signs of Safety and Wellbeing model. We focus on empowering individuals by building on their existing strengths helping them achieve their goals and live more independently.

Our team includes a Team Manager Senior Practitioner Social Workers and Senior Independence and Wellbeing Practitioners - a group of passionate supportive and welcoming professionals. We currently operate a hybrid working model offering flexibility between home and office-based work.

With a collaborative and forward-thinking management team we are deeply committed to continuous professional development.
